CALL US: +1 (905) 434-1694
MD, FRCSC – Ophthalmologist
OD – Optometrist
MD, FRCS(C) – Ophthalmologist
Mon-Thurs: 9:00am – 5:30pm
Friday: 9:00am – 5:00pm
Sat & Sun: Closed
FREE Parking at Rear of Building.
Wheelchair Accessible
Elevator In Building
Accessibility Tools